No, not all tile floors are waterproof. A tile's waterproof capability depends entirely on its water absorption rate. Porcelain tiles, with an absorption rate below 0.5%, are waterproof. Ceramic tiles, with rates above 10%, are not. Grout lines are also weak points and need waterproof sealant.

Is a Lower Water Absorption Rate Always Better?
You've been told that a lower water absorption rate is the mark of a quality tile. So you insist on the lowest rate for every project. But this could cause your wall tiles to fail, sliding right off the wall. Knowing where to apply this rule is critical.
For floor tiles, yes, a lower water absorption rate (under 0.5%) is superior for durability and stain resistance. However, for wall tiles, a slightly higher rate (around 10-15%) is actually beneficial, as it helps the tile bond more securely to the mortar or adhesive.

Let's break this down, because it’s a crucial distinction for anyone specifying materials for a large project. Floor tiles need to be warriors. They face foot traffic, heavy furniture, spills, and constant cleaning. A low water absorption rate means the tile is very dense. We achieve this by using refined clays and firing them at extremely high temperatures. This density makes porcelain tile incredibly strong, hard to stain, and almost impossible for water to penetrate. It’s exactly what you need for floors in kitchens, bathrooms, and commercial spaces.
Wall tiles, on the other hand, have a different job. They don’t get walked on. Their main challenge is staying put on a vertical surface. A ceramic wall tile is more porous by design. This slight absorbency allows it to "drink" a little moisture from the cement mortar or tile adhesive, creating a stronger, more permanent bond. If you used a non-porous porcelain tile on a wall with traditional mortar, it could have trouble gripping. I always tell my clients to think of it this way:
| Tile Type | Ideal Water Absorption | Primary Reason |
|---|---|---|
| Floor Tile (Porcelain) | < 0.5% | High density provides strength, durability, and water/stain resistance. |
| Wall Tile (Ceramic) | 10% - 15% | Porosity helps it adhere strongly to vertical surfaces with mortar. |
A simple trick I use when inspecting samples is to turn a tile over and pour a little water on the unglazed back. If the water sits there like a bead, you’re looking at a dense, high-quality porcelain. If it soaks in quickly, it’s a more porous ceramic.
Does a Thicker Tile Mean Better Quality?
It’s easy to assume that a thicker tile is a stronger, better tile. This leads many buyers to pay a premium for chunky tiles, thinking they're getting more value. But you could be buying a thick, porous tile that’s actually weaker than a thinner, denser alternative.
No, thickness is not the best indicator of a tile's quality or strength. The most important factor is density. A denser tile is stronger, more durable, and more resistant to impact, even if it's thinner. When comparing two tiles of the same size, the heavier one is usually denser and better.

In our factory, we are obsessed with density. Density is the result of using superior raw materials and perfecting the firing process. When a tile is fired at over 1200°C, the particles fuse together tightly, eliminating voids and creating a compact, robust body. This is what gives porcelain its incredible strength. A poorly made, low-fired tile might be thick, but it will be full of microscopic air pockets, making it brittle and prone to chipping and water absorption.
Think of it like comparing a solid block of oak to a thick piece of styrofoam. The oak is thinner but infinitely stronger because of its density. The same principle applies to tiles. This is why the tile industry has successfully moved towards high-performance slim tiles. These products are incredibly strong and durable yet are lightweight, easier to transport, and ideal for renovation projects where you need to tile over existing surfaces. So, the next time you're evaluating samples, don't just look at the thickness. Pick them up. For two tiles of the same dimensions, the heavier one is your winner. It tells you it’s packed with quality material, not air.
What Common Mistakes Should You Avoid When Sourcing Tiles?
Sourcing materials for a large project is full of risks. You're putting your trust in a supplier miles away. A single mistake can lead to receiving low-quality products, wrong quantities, or mismatched colors, jeopardizing your timeline, budget, and professional reputation.
The biggest sourcing mistakes include accepting mislabeled water absorption rates, receiving a lower grade of tile than paid for, being shorted on quantity, and getting products that don't match the showroom sample. Always verify specifications independently and inspect all goods thoroughly upon arrival.

I've worked with hundreds of international buyers, and I've seen these painful mistakes happen. As a manufacturer, our reputation depends on preventing them. Here are the top pitfalls and how a professional partner helps you avoid them.
Pitfall 1: Falsified Specifications
Some suppliers might label a semi-porous tile with a water absorption rate of 3% as "porcelain" to command a higher price. Using this in a wet area would be a disaster.
- How to Check: Don't just trust the box. Perform the simple water test on the back of a sample tile. A true porcelain tile (<0.5% absorption) will not absorb the water.
Pitfall 2: Grade Swapping
You order "Premium Grade" tiles, which should have no defects, but you receive "First Grade" or "Standard Grade" boxes, which allow for a certain percentage of pieces with minor flaws like chips or color variations.
- How to Check: When your shipment arrives, open several random boxes from different pallets. Inspect the tiles for consistency, edge straightness, and surface defects. Our factory has a multi-stage QC process to ensure grade integrity.
Pitfall 3: Quantity Shortages
This is a simple but costly scam. You pay for 1,000 square meters, but the shipment only contains 950.
- How to Check: Do the math. Count the number of boxes, check the square meters per box printed on the side, and calculate the total. Never assume the packing list is correct without verification.
Pitfall 4: Sample vs. Production Mismatch
The beautiful sample you approved in the showroom looks nothing like the tiles that arrived. This is often due to a different production batch.
- How to Check: When you place your order, insist that the batch number is confirmed and that your entire order is fulfilled from that single batch. A reliable manufacturer maintains batch consistency and transparency.
